Forum de Statistiques
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
-17%
Le deal à ne pas rater :
SSD interne Crucial SSD P3 1To NVME à 49,99€
49.99 € 59.99 €
Voir le deal

contrôler le nombre de chiffre apres la virgule sur SAS

2 participants

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ty contrôler le nombre de chiffre apres la virgule sur SAS

Message par parvn Mer 26 Fév 2014 - 20:43

Comment faire pour contrôler soit même le nombre de chiffre à afficher après la virgule dans un tableau en utilisant la procédure  proc print ?

parvn

Nombre de messages : 13
Date d'inscription : 20/01/2010

Revenir en haut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ty Re: contrôler le nombre de chiffre apres la virgule sur SAS

Message par niaboc Jeu 27 Fév 2014 - 7:11

Tu dois pouvoir le faire avec des formats sur tes variables.

Il faut aller voir du côté du format COMMA je pense.

Niaboc
niaboc
niaboc

Nombre de messages : 1001
Age : 37
Localisation : Paris
Date d'inscription : 05/05/2008

Revenir en haut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ty Re: contrôler le nombre de chiffre apres la virgule sur SAS

Message par parvn Jeu 27 Fév 2014 - 18:37

Oui, mais même quand je modifie le format COMMA comme tu as dit, quand j’exécute le proc print sur ma table, la table affichée ne prend pas en compte les modifications du format COMMA que j'ai faite.

parvn

Nombre de messages : 13
Date d'inscription : 20/01/2010

Revenir en haut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ty Re: contrôler le nombre de chiffre apres la virgule sur SAS

Message par niaboc Ven 28 Fév 2014 - 15:24

Essaye de t'inspirer de ce code, ça marche bien chez moi :

Code:
data c;
    input a;
    cards;
    2.52598
    ;
run;

proc print data=c;
    var a;
    format a comma10.2;
run;

Dis moi si c'est ok maintenant.
niaboc
niaboc

Nombre de messages : 1001
Age : 37
Localisation : Paris
Date d'inscription : 05/05/2008

Revenir en haut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ty Re: contrôler le nombre de chiffre apres la virgule sur SAS

Message par niaboc Ven 28 Fév 2014 - 15:26

Code:
data c;
    input a;
    format a comma10.2;
    cards;
    2.52598
    ;
run;

proc print data=c;
    var a;
run;

ce code là marche aussi chez moi
niaboc
niaboc

Nombre de messages : 1001
Age : 37
Localisation : Paris
Date d'inscription : 05/05/2008

Revenir en haut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ty Re: contrôler le nombre de chiffre apres la virgule sur SAS

Message par parvn Ven 28 Fév 2014 - 17:23

Oui c'est ok, merci encore Niaboc

parvn

Nombre de messages : 13
Date d'inscription : 20/01/2010

Revenir en haut Aller en bas

contrôler le nombre de chiffre apres la virgule sur SAS Empty Re: contrôler le nombre de chiffre apres la virgule sur SAS

Message par Contenu sponsorisé


Contenu sponsorisé


Revenir en haut Aller en bas

Revenir en haut

- Sujets similaires

 
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um